Summary

This is a retrospective, fully-crossed, multi-reader, multi-case (MRMC) study to evaluate the effectiveness of 'CadAI-B Dx' (CadAI-B) for decision support in breast ultrasound. The study compares the diagnostic performance of readers interpreting breast ultrasound images with and without the aid of CadAI-B. A total of 797 patient cases will be included, comprising 350 cases with a confirmed diagnosis of malignancy and 447 cases with a confirmed benign diagnosis. Sixteen readers will participate in the study to evaluate the device.

Detailed description

The study utilizes a crossover design where all readers independently review all cases. The control arm consists of a reading session where participating readers independently review cases without the assistance of the CadAI-B device (unaided reading). The experimental arm involves reading with CadAI-B assistance (AI-aided reading). To minimize potential bias, a washout period of four weeks will be maintained between the unassisted and assisted reading sessions for each reader. The primary hypothesis is that CadAI-B assistance significantly improves overall reader performance in breast ultrasound interpretation, as measured by the area under the Localization Receiver Operating Characteristic (LROC) curve (AULROC).

DEVICECadAI-B DxCadAI-B Dx is a Software as a Medical Device (SaMD) designed to assist physicians by providing Computer-Aided Detection (CADe) and Diagnosis (CADx) capabilities in breast ultrasound interpretation. The software automatically processes the image to identify suspicious regions (Lesion Detection) and provides a quantitative malignancy score (CadAI-Score) mapped to a corresponding BI-RADS Category. It also analyzes lesion size and BI-RADS lexicon descriptors.
